US President Donald Trump is actively seeking Arab nations such as Saudi Arabia and other Gulf states to share financial costs associated with ongoing military operations against Iran while separate diplomatic channels remain open for peace negotiations in Tehran on terms including prisoner exchanges or nuclear concessions that could stabilize regional security guarantees amid escalating tensions across the Middle East.

    US officials confirm President Donald Trump is interested in asking Arab nations to share the financial costs of a war with Iran.

    White House spokesperson Karoline Leavitt stated that calling on Middle Eastern countries for funding would be an idea under consideration by the president, though she avoided making definitive commitments ahead of him.
Mar 30, 22:22 White House press secretary Karoline Leavitt stated that President Donald Trump is weighing the idea of asking Arab nations to share the financial burden of the war with Iran.
Mar 30, 18:45 Karolene Leavitt confirmed at a news briefing on Mar. 30 that it was an 'idea' Trump had and he would be quite interested in calling Arab allies to help pay for the war cost.

White House Press Secretary Karoline Leavitt stated that President Trump would consider asking Arab nations in the Middle East for financial contributions toward military costs related to an ongoing conflict with Iran, even as Washington reports progress on negotiations and notes a discrepancy between Tehran's public statements and private communications.
